There are 3 Landscape Designers in Southington, Connecticut.
Find addresses, phone numbers, fax numbers, hours & services for Southington Landscape Designers.
Birch Hill Landscape & Design 356 Lazy Lane Southington, CT Landscape Design, Landscaping
Della Construction & Landscaping 29 North Liberty Street Southington, CT Gardening, Landscape Design, Landscaping
Gentile Landscaping 239 Debbie Drive Southington, CT Landscape Design, Landscaping